This route from Scranton, Pennsylvania to Mackinaw City, Michigan covers roughly 650 miles and 10-11 hours of driving. A historical quirk: the final stretch along I-75 in Michigan passes over the Mackinac Bridge, the longest suspension bridge in the Western Hemisphere, opening in 1957 and connecting Michigan's two peninsulas.

The journey traverses the Appalachians, Ohio farmland, and Michigan's northern forests. It's a classic Great Lakes corridor with diverse stops.

Road Safety, Family Stops, and Fatigue Management

Infrastructure safety: I-80 and I-75 are well-maintained; watch for deer in Michigan. Rest stops every 30-50 miles. Fatigue management: break every 2 hours at rest areas or towns like Clarion, PA; Sandusky, OH.

  • Family-friendly: Cedar Point (Sandusky, OH), Mackinac Island ferries.
  • Pet-friendly: Most rest stops have pet areas; motels like Motel 6 are pet-friendly.
  • Hidden off-route spots: Kirtland, OH (Mormon historic sites), Taquamenon Falls (MI, detour).
